What is the difference between the 6th and the 7th precept ? It seems to me that they are both about not talking and thinking bad about others and thus not raising our ego.

The sixth precepts says to not talk badly about those monks and nuns, who are also in training with you. Not going there where its is about whose fault it is, whose merit it is. The Buddha also said that if we are pure in mind, we do not go to these kind of comparisons.
The seventh precept is about not comparing one another´s path and understanding. If we are awakened, the thought that someone else were mistaken would not arrive. The truth of this precept is that we are one with heaven and earth.
